About the Role : The Operations Excellence Consultant will provide strategic and hands-on leadership to drive performance improvement initiatives across Loyola Medicine, part of Trinity Health. This role supports stabilization, standardization, simplification, and sustainability of operational and clinical processes. The Consultant will lead and mentor staff at all levels, developing problem-solving skills to enhance patient care, meet regulatory standards, and improve operational metrics such as patient safety, quality, cycle time, rework, financial stewardship, and employee satisfaction. The role involves guiding leaders on process excellence strategies and fostering a culture of continuous improvement through training in Lean, Change Acceleration, Rapid Process Improvement, and Six Sigma methodologies.
